In a bit of housecleaning type news, the Patriots have given veteran wide receiver Torry Holt an injury settlement. The essence of what this means is that Holt is no longer part of the club, he is a free agent. Holt was scheduled to undergo surgery on his knee this week after the Patriots placed him on season-ending injured reserve Sunday. Now, with Holt getting an injury settlement, he could potentially play this season for another club if he returns to full health. Source: ESPN Boston
